State sues Apple for negligence over the alleged distribution of child sexual abuse materials on iCloud and devices
The West Virginia attorney general’s office sued Apple on Thursday, claiming the tech giant allowed child sexual abuse materials (CSAM) to be stored and distributed on its iCloud service.

Apple Sued Over Allegations of CSAM on iCloud
Apple is facing a lawsuit filed Thursday by West Virginia Attorney General JB McCuskey over allegations that iCloud is being used to store and distribute child sexual abuse material online.

Apple inks deal for IMAX screenings of live Formula 1 races
Formula 1 has been receiving star treatment from Apple for awhile, and now the racing series will literally be getting even bigger. Apple is partnering with IMAX to show five races from the 2026 season.

Apple’s Emergency SOS Helped Save 6 Skiers After California’s Deadliest Avalanche—Here’s How to Use It Yourself

The survivors stayed in contact with emergency responders using Apple’s Emergency SOS, which allows users to text for help even without cellular service or Wi-Fi. The phones connected directly to satellites, enabling communication with the Nevada County Sheriff’s Office coordinating the rescue, according to The New York Times.
